Book excerpt: Estimation of genetic paramenters from a selected population using an animal model was studied along with several problems in optimization of selection response with an acceptable rate of imbreeding in poultry populations using various methods of genetic evaluation, restrictions on selection, mating ratios and population sizes. The genetic parameters for 6 recent generations of a selected commercial egg-laying poultry popuolation were estimated using a derivative free restricted maximum likeihood procedure based on an animal model. The estimated genetic variances for five economically important traits were found to be influenced by the number of generations of data used in the evaluation. This in the evaluation. This finding was examined in a simulation study with different population sizes and different selection intensities for males and females. A normal and a sex-limited trait, both with heritabilities of 0.1 or 0.5 were considered. Estimated additive genetic variance for both the normal and sex-limited trait with a heritability of 0.1 did not show any clear trend as the number of generations of data were increased. But for a heritability of 0.5, the estimated geneticvariances decreased as the number of generations used in the estimation decreased. Use of two generations data led to underestimates of truegenetic variance and use of 5 generations led to over estimates. The exact combination of conditions leading to these biases was not identified and the need for further research was highlighted. The diferences in genetic response and rate of inbreeding were examined by stochasticsimulation of egg-laying poultry selection stocks for traits with heritabilities of 0.1, 0.2 and 0.5 when selecting on estimated breeding values using an individual animal model evaluation (BLUP) or evaluation based on family selecting indexes. The BLUP evaluation gave slightly higher selection responses then the selection indexes, with the differences being almost non-existent at high heritability. But BLUP also gave considerably higher rates then selection indexes. Thus, on the basisof response and inbreeding there seems to be advantage to applying BLUP evaluations for egg-laying poultry stocks. The effects of mating ratio, population size and restrictions on the selecton of close relatives on the selection response and rate of inbreeding were examined by stochastic simulation. Selecton was based on an index comprising 3 economically important traits in egg-laying poultry. The simulation resultsshowed thet population size of around 3000 recorded females and a mating ratio in the range of 1:8 to 1:6 (male:female) would be appropriateto get good selection responses (about $8.5 Cdn. after generation 10) with moderate rates of inbreeding (about 1.2 to 1.5% per generation).

Book excerpt: A 2 x 2 x 2N confounded diallel mating design (2 series, 2 males, N females per male per series) was used to obtain estimates of the genetic parameters in body weight traits in a noninbred population of New Hampshire chickens grown on 18% and 24% protein rations. Individual selection also was applied to evaluate the reliability of the genetic parameters obtained under each protein level. The analysis showed an extremely large contribution of series effects to the total variation in the traits which was attributed to the environmental influences from one series to the other and to the maternal environment. The component of variance due to series x male interaction was found to be small or zero under the 24% protein ration. An optimal environment may have given certain genotypes a greater opportunity to adapt to the environment. The higher estimates of the component of variance of series x female interaction for one-day body weight suggests the influence of maternal effects from one series to the other and from one dam to the other. Generally, estimates for the component of variance of male effects were higher under the 18% protein ration than under the 24% protein ration. Conversely, the component of variance of female effects showed higher values under the 24% protein ration than under 18% protein ration for most of the traits considered. ...

In this comprehensive research book issues associated with poultry breeding are addressed, by examining quantitative and molecular genetics and the uses of transgenic technology. The important area of disease resistance and transmission is also covered in a special section looking at the genetics of disease resistance. This book represents the first complete integration of our current knowledge of biotechnology and quantitative and molecular genetics as applied to poultry breeding.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Many behaviors in poultry can be modified by genetic selection. Selection of laying hens for maximum egg production had the unfortunate side effect of increased rates of beak inflicted damage on other birds. Selective breeding has eliminated broodiness and has either increased or decreased other behaviors, such as hysteria, fearfulness, appetite in broilers, social dominance, ability and damage to other birds. Genetic selection can be used to reduce behaviors that cause welfare problems. However, it must be approached with caution to avoid unintended consequences that would be detrimental to welfare. A calm, docile bird that appears behaviorally calm, may take longer for its heart rate to return to normal after it is frightened. The use of group selection instead of single-bird selection can be effectively used to reduce undesirable behaviors such as feather pecking and to maintain high egg production. An entire group of birds is selected instead of selecting individuals.
